From: ZnO-Cu/Mn nanozyme for rescuing the intestinal homeostasis in Salmonella-induced colitis

The antibacterial and anti-inflammatory effect of ZnO-CM in vivo in a Salmonella-infected enteritis model. Groups are divided into Control, Model, ZnO (50 mg/kg), ZnO-CM-L (25 mg/kg), and ZnO-CM-H (50 mg/kg). (A) Schematic of the mouse model establishment and subsequent testing of antibacterial effects in the colon and small intestine. (B) Mortality curves (n = 20). (C) curves of body weight in mice. (D) Comparison of colon length after treatment of Salmonella infection. (E) Quantification of colon length. (F) ex vivo visceral imaging showing bacterial concentration and distribution. (G.H) groups of small intestine and colon bacteria smear photos and quantification after treatment. (I) immunofluorescence observations tissue section distribution of bacteria. (J) Hematoxylin-eosin (HE) staining of tissue sections of the small intestine and colon. (K.L) expression levels of inflammation-related proteins. n = 10, * p < 0.05, ** p < 0.01, *** p < 0.001
